Orange is a town in Schuyler County, New York, United States. The population was 1,752 at the 2000 census. The Town of Orange is in the southwestern part of the county and is east of Bath. [edit] History
The first settlements took place circa 1798. The town was formed from Town of Wayne in 1813 as the "Town of Jersey" while still part of Steuben County. The current name was adopted in 1836. Orange was increased by parts of Hornby (1842) and Bradford (1854). The town was made part of the new Schuyler County in 1854. [edit] Research Tips
